Cast members Me - (DH) – Andy DW – Sigrid DD1 – Steph – mid-twenties DD1BF – Andrew – mid-twenties DD2 – Bex – 18 DS – Xander – 15 [Severely Autistic] Well, it had been over 13 years since the Cooke’s embarked on “We Don’t Do Queues 2006”, at Easter. We’ve been out twice since, on the “Hey, let’s do Disney again 2008” one week trip (where we discovered we had enough Tesco Clubcard points to pay for flights and accommodation for a week in Orlando) and the “All Together Again 2013” trip in 2013 when we were able to take my mother with us again. This time, we were heading for late August, on the philosophy that: - Queues are lighter - Although hotter, we’ve been out there in an Easter heatwave that matched August temperatures. As we were stuck to school holidays (because of DD2 and DS), we had to come up with dates that fit there. In Florida, the schools go back mid-August, and this is similar in many other States, so crowds should - should - be lighter. We'd not been out since the change in FastPasses (I'd got the hang of the old system and was very skeptical about the new one), so I wanted to have the minimum possible crowds - and with school holidays, Christmas looked unlikely to provide, Easter, likewise, and the summer holidays... well, the last two weeks of them were likely the best option. Temperature did look pretty challenging, though, but as I said, we've been out there in an Easter heatwave that was supposedly as bad as August gets. We knew about the rain, so we prepared for it. I went on the Dibb to get as prepared as possible FastPass-wise. DW sat me down in front of the computer with a few months to go and kept me plied with tea and Diet Coke (in seperate cups/glasses - I'm not a monster) and instructions to get prepped. I worked out an itinerary, then a schedule within those days, got FastPasses booked the moment they became available, and learned all about tap-grab-modify.
